What is recorded here

Detached three-bay single-storey brick cottage, built c.1880. A recent plain glazed lean-to entrance porch is built over the replacement door which is part glazed. To the north is a canted single-storey timber bay. Window openings are all flat-headed with one over one top-hung uPVC frames. The pitched roof is finished with artificial slate and cast-iron rainwater goods; clay decorative crested ridge tiles. One brick and one rendered chimneystack both with corbelled caps and clay pots. The house is slightly set back behind a low rendered wall with square gate pillars and wrought-iron gate.
A modest but nevertheless important example of a somewhat picturesque cottage of the late Victorian era.
